![]() Free Download Nicole Nyffenegger, "Authorising History: Gestures of Authorship in Fourteenth-century English Historiography" English | ISBN: 1443848190 | 2013 | 230 pages | PDF | 1117 KB This book discusses the strategies and rhetorical means by which four authors of Middle English verse historiography seek to authorise their works and themselves. Paying careful attention to the texts, it traces the ways in which authors inscribe their fictional selves and seek to give authority to their constructions of history. It further investigates how the authors position themselves in relation to their task of writing history, their sources and their audiences. Now in its second edition, this ground-breaking work addresses speech production characteristics and provides detailed instruction in both phonetic and phonemic transcription of the dialect. Each chapter features practical exercises to allow readers to develop skills and test their knowledge as they progress through the text. These exercises are complemented by an extensive companion website, which contains valuable explanatory materials, audio examples and accompanying activities for students. A new assessment bank includes exercises of varying difficulty, allowing lecturers to build unique assessment tasks tailored to their students' needs. Jetzt ist Wallraff wieder undercover unterwegs...Niemand hat mehr Missstände aufgedeckt als er. Millionen haben seine Bücher gelesen, junge Journalisten nehmen sich an ihm ein Vorbild, wenn sie in Rollen schlüpfen, um die dunklen Seiten der gesellschaftlichen Realität aufzudecken - eine Vorgehensweise, die im Schwedischen wallraffa genannt wird. Doch Günter Wallraff hat sich nicht zur Ruhe gesetzt. Seit einiger Zeit ist er wieder undercover unterwegs. Als Michael G. recherchierte er den Alltag in deutschen Callcentern - das Echo auf die in der Zeit veröffentlichte Reportage war gewaltig: Wallraff war Gast in Fernseh- und Hörfunksendungen; zahlreiche Callcenter-Mitarbeiter meldeten sich, die ihm von eigenen Erlebnissen berichteten. Der zweite Coup: Als Niedriglöhner arbeitete Wallraff in einer Fabrik, die für Lidl Brötchen backt, bis zur Erschöpfung, erlitt mehrfach - wie auch seine Kollegen - Brandverletzungen. Dem Lidl-Aufsichtsratschef Klaus Gehrig schlug Wallraff in der Sendung Kerner vor, gemeinsam mit ihm zwei Tage lang unter diesen Straflager-Bedingungen zu arbeiten - was dieser ablehnte. Und im Winter 2008/2009 hat Günter Wallraff am eigenen Leibe erfahren, wie Obdachlose in Deutschland leben. Er quartierte sich in Obdachlosenheimen ein und verbrachte die kältesten Tage des Winters auf der Straße, bei Temperaturen bis zu minus 20 Grad.Neben einer vierten Rolle, die bis zum Erscheinen geheim bleiben muss, und weiteren Fällen dokumentiert Wallraff in diesem Buch erstmals umfassend die Ergebnisse seiner neuen Recherchen, die auch nach den Presseveröffentlichungen weitergehen. Sein Fazit: In einem reichen Land leben heute immer mehr Menschen ganz unten, und das droht die Gesellschaft zu zerreißen. Gesamtauflage von Ganz unten: über 5 Mio.
